Markets all year round

The Naponda Farmers Market is held on the second Saturday of the month in Waring Gardens. Expect wonderful bread, fruit and veggies, preserves and conserves – a great opportunity to pick up lunch and some treats for the weekend.

The Lions Community Market, also in the Waring Gardens, kicks off around 8:30am on the fourth Saturday of every month. This is a great place to pick up seedlings for your veggie patch and garden or find interesting collectables, clothing and jewellery.

Mother’s and Father’s Day markets

The popular Naponda Mother’s Day Fair (second Sunday in May) in Deniliquin is a great place to take mum to enjoy coffee, tea and cakes, and pick up a special gift. And don’t miss the Pretty Pine Father’s Day Market (first Sunday in September) at the Pretty Pine Recreation reserve, 20 minutes’ drive north of Deniliquin. This family fun day starts at 10am (dad needs a sleep in!) and features market stalls, machinery demonstrations, dog jump competition, kids’ activities and more.
